The Golden 1 review: approval odds, rates and grade (2025)

The Golden 1 earns a D, weaker than most home-equity (HELOC) lenders. It turned down 37.7% of the applications it decided on in 2025, which ranks in the 13th percentile for approval odds. Its median loan was priced 0.53 points above the average prime offer rate, ranking in the 22nd percentile on pricing. Compared against 412 home-equity (HELOC) lenders using 2025 HMDA filings.

Frequently asked questions

The Golden 1 denied 37.7% of the applications it decided on in 2025. The national figure across all lenders was 22.6%. On approval odds it ranks in the 13th percentile of home-equity (HELOC) lenders.

The most common reason The Golden 1 gave in 2025 was "debt-to-income ratio", cited on 39.1% of its denials. Lenders report up to four reasons per denial to the CFPB; the full breakdown is on this page.

The median interest rate on loans The Golden 1 originated in 2025 was 7.75%, and its median rate spread over the average prime offer rate was 0.53 points. Rates on this page are what borrowers actually got, not advertised rates.

In 2025, 15% of its applications were for home purchases, 27% for refinancing (including cash-out), and 57% for home improvement or other purposes. By loan type: 99% conventional, 1% FHA, 0% VA.

Every figure on this page comes from the Home Mortgage Disclosure Act (HMDA) Loan/Application Register published by the CFPB, which lenders are required by federal law to file. We add the grade and the comparisons; we do not add facts.

About this data. HMDA data is published once a year by the CFPB. The current release covers applications acted on in calendar year 2025. Figures describe applications the lender acted on, including loans it later sold. Interest rates and costs are medians on originated loans only; some depository institutions are exempt from reporting pricing fields, which is why a few cells read "—".
